JOB DETAILS
Jobot is partnering with a growing and reputable law firm to staff a position for a Client Financial Services Specialist role. They are seeking an innovative, collaborative, and service-oriented Client Financial Services Specialist in our Cleveland office.
D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
- Performs credit searches for new client intake and provides credit relations approval.
- Develops and maintains monitoring processes and informative reports for WIP and AR.
- Initiates the timely review of WIP and AR with attorneys to collaborate on appropriate client specific action plans.
- Initiates phone calls and email communications with clients to facilitate collections of aging accounts consistent with the firm’s established policies.
- Records client collections efforts and follow up activities within the accounting system.
- Records discounted AR transactions consistent with the firm’s established policies.
- Generates monthly AR statements and provides informative client collections correspondence.
- Serves as the office’s primary contact for internal and external accounts receivable inquiries.
- Provides routine status updates to the office partner in charge and other firm leadership.
- Researches unallocated credits/payments and coordinates appropriate actions necessary for resolution.
- Coordinates the routine review and resolution of dormant trust accounts.
- Prepares client refunds for approval and submission to accounts payable.
- Continuously maintains and supports efficient workflows and processes.

Entry Level Financial Specialist Jobs: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get an entry level financial specialist job?
Entry level financial specialist roles typically look for candidates with a finance, accounting, or economics degree, but relevant internships, coursework, or even a capstone project can substitute for work history. Employers at this level want to see attention to detail, comfort with spreadsheets or financial software, and a basic understanding of budgeting or reporting. Tailoring your resume to highlight any hands-on data or analysis experience gives you a clear edge.
